Once you have a strong internet connection, head over to the Messages app and try downloading the pictures again. 2.In the Messages app on your Mac, select a conversation, then click the Info button in the top-right corner. Click Download at the bottom of Info view. If you don’t see Download, all of your photos and videos are downloaded (or currently downloading) to your Mac. After your photos and videos are downloaded, drag individual items to another ...Oct 12, 2021 ... Feb 19, 2024 · This is one of the most common causes of images not loading in iMessage. To check this: Open the Settings app . Tap Messages. Enable the MMS Messaging toggle if it isn't already switched on. The toggle will be green and to the right when it is enabled. If you can see the photos in iMessage, you've resolved the issue! And click disable and download messages. 3.Method 2: Check Date and Time Settings. iMessage-related services require accurate dates and times to sync #images. If there is a problem with them, then it is very likely to cause iMessage photos not showing. Therefore, you can go to Settings > General > Date & Time and ensure that Set Automatically is turned on.Saving a photo, video, or other attachment in iMessage will not notify others.
